内容
隐藏
docker安装
镜像选择 henrist/zerotier-one
docker目录映射 /var/lib/zerotier-one
网络设置为hosts模式
启动后 通过命令执行 输入 ash 进入ssh
执行 zerotier-cli join 你的网络ID
这样就加入到Zerotier One了 去网站授权即可
Nat 设置
进入群晖 root ssh
vi /etc/sysctl.conf
加入 net.ipv4.ip_forward=1 打开IP转发
iptables 设置
iptables -t nat -A POSTROUTING -s 172.22.22.0/24 -j MASQUERADE
172.22.22.0/24 是zerone 设置的或者分配的ip 不是本地的
这样其他设备可访问局域网的IP段了
解决重启失效
/sbin/iptables -t nat -A POSTROUTING -s 172.22.22.0/24 -j MASQUERADE
创建 iptables.sh 到root
vi /root/iptables.sh
#!/bin/bash sleep 1m iptables -t nat -A POSTROUTING -s 172.22.22.0/24 -j MASQUERADE
群晖内 打开控制面板 - 任务计划 - 触发的任务 - 用户自定义的脚本
填入 /root/iptables.sh